XRCC6 Antibody
XRCC6 is a nuclear complex consisting of two subunits with molecular masses of approximately 70 and 80 kDa. The complex functions as a single-stranded DNA-dependent ATP-dependent helicase. The complex may be involved in the repair of nonhomologous DNA ends such as that required for double-strand break repair, transposition, and V (D) J recombination. High levels of autoantibodies to p70 and p80 have been found in some patients with systemic lupus erythematosus.
